Lerato Mikateko Ngobeni is a South African politician serving as a Member of the National Assembly of South Africa since the 2024 general election. She currently serves as the parliamentary chief whip for ActionSA. Before her national parliamentary career, she was a councillor for the City of Johannesburg and chaired the council's environment and infrastructure services committee. Ngobeni has a professional background as a programme manager and sustainability specialist, having worked with Harvard University's Centre for African Studies and coordinated readiness efforts for the 2010 FIFA World Cup. She holds a Bachelor of Arts in Political Science from Johnson C. Smith University, graduating summa cum laude.
